How much do packaging machine operator j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for packaging machine operator in New Brunswick, NJ is $20.62,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.36 and $22.84 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a packaging machine operator do?

A packaging machine operator is responsible for setting up, operating, and maintaining packaging machinery to ensure products are packed efficiently and accurately. They monitor the machines during operation, troubleshoot issues, and perform quality checks to meet safety and production standards. The role often requires attention to detail, knowledge of safety procedures, and the ability to work in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.

Is packaging machine operator hard?

Packaging machine operators typically perform repetitive tasks and need to pay close attention to detail to ensure products are correctly packaged. The job may require standing for long periods and operating machinery safely, but with proper training, it is generally manageable for most individuals. Skills in machinery operation and safety protocols are important for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a packaging machine operator?

To thrive as a Packaging Machine Operator, you need m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with automated packaging machinery, basic computer systems, and safety certifications like OSHA are typ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, teamwork, and effective communication help operators adapt to production changes and prevent downtime. These skills are crucial for maintaining product quality, operational efficiency, and workplace safety.

What is the difference between Packaging Machine Operator vs Material Handler?

AspectPackaging Machine OperatorMaterial Handler
Primary RoleOperates packaging machinery to package products efficientlyMoves, loads, and unloads materials and products within a facility
Skills & CertificationsMechanical skills, attention to detail, safety trainingForklift certification, physical stamina, safety awareness
Work EnvironmentManufacturing or production linesWarehouses, distribution centers
Industry UsageFood, pharmaceuticals, consumer goodsLogistics, manufacturing, distribution

While both roles are essential in manufacturing and logistics, Packaging Machine Operators focus on operating and maintaining packaging equipment, ensuring products are properly sealed and labeled. Material Handlers primarily manage the movement and storage of materials within facilities. Understanding these differences helps job seekers identify the right career path based on skills and interests.

What are the most common challenges packaging machine operators face during a typical shift?

Packaging Machine Operators frequently encounter challenges such as troubleshooting equipment malfunctions, maintaining consistent product quality, and meeting production deadlines. Operators must stay alert to quickly identify and resolve minor mechanical issues, ensuring minimal downtime. Additionally, they need to follow strict safety and hygiene protocols, often while working in fast-paced environments with repetitive tasks. Strong attention to detail and good communication skills are essential for collaborating with maintenance teams and supervisors when more complex problems arise.
